SentinelOne, Inc. (NYSE:S – Get Free Report) insider Ana Pinczuk sold 32,396 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Wednesday, March 25th. The stock was sold at an average price of $13.37, for a total value of $433,134.52. Following the transaction, the insider owned 603,650 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$8,070,800.50. This represents a 5.09%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this link.
SentinelOne Trading Up 0.5%
Shares of NYSE S opened at $13.42 on Friday. The stock has a market capitalization of $4.56 billion, a PE ratio of -9.87 and a beta of 0.77. SentinelOne, Inc. has a twelve month low of $12.23 and a twelve month high of $21.40. The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of $13.76 and a 200-day simple moving average of $15.57.
SentinelOne (NYSE:S –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, March 12th. The company reported $0.07 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.06 by $0.01. SentinelOne had a negative return on equity of 15.04% and a negative net margin of 45.02%.The firm had revenue of $271.15 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$271.18 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$0.04 EPS. SentinelOne’s revenue was up 20.3% on a year-over-year basis. SentinelOne has set its FY 2027 guidance at 0.320-0.380 EPS and its Q1 2027 guidance at 0.010-0.020 EPS. On average, equities analysts predict that SentinelOne, Inc. will post -0.76 earnings per share for the current year.

SentinelOne Company Profile
SentinelOne, Inc is a cybersecurity company specializing in AI-driven, autonomous endpoint protection. Founded in 2013 and headquartered in Mountain View, California, the firm developed its Singularity Platform to unify prevention, detection, response, and hunting across endpoints, cloud workloads, containers and IoT devices. SentinelOne’s solutions leverage machine learning and behavioral analytics to identify threats in real time, automate remediation workflows and deliver forensics to support rapid incident response.
The company’s flagship product suite includes endpoint security agents, cloud workload protection, identity threat detection and extended detection and response (XDR) capabilities.
